Extended Description

EDS2184 S769 EM Eaton Crouse-Hinds: Eaton Crouse-Hinds series EDS pushbutton control station, With pushbuttons, Emergency, Feraloy iron alloy, Single circuit universal, 1, Single-gang, 1, Maintained contact mushroom head with lockout and guard, Dead end, 3/4", 600 Vac

600 Vac capability delivers safe, high-performance control for heavy loads in hazardous locations, reducing voltage-related fault risks and enabling compliant operation on demanding equipment. This translates to lower downtime and fewer reworks during installations in chemical, oil and gas, and mining facilities, especially where explosion-protected devices are mandated. The single-gang, 3/4" trade size footprint minimizes panel real estate needs, simplifying panel design and reducing installation time while maintaining robust accessibility for maintenance checks. With one pushbutton and a dedicated emergency indication plate, operators gain immediate actuation and clear status signaling, enhancing response times during critical events and improving overall process safety. The maintained mushroom head with lockout and guard features adds a secondary safety layer, preventing accidental resets during maintenance or servicing, which lowers risk and supports regulatory compliance. Feraloy iron alloy construction provides rugged durability in extreme environments, resisting impact, corrosion, and thermal cycling to extend service life and reduce replacement costs.
